Cyclonezephyrxz7
24th August 2009, 12:53 AM
Well, i just used a text editor to look at my phone's CommManager link on the start menu ...
Running Ookba's 3VO 2.5 (with the WiFi Patch installed) it says this:
39#"\Windows\CommManager.exe"
?\Windows\SP_ProgramIcon.dll,-110
The second line is for the links icon...the first line points to where the Communications Manager program is...make sure it matches that...
By the way...are you launching comm manager from the start menu or from the CComm panel on the homescreen, or are you using the 'hold down the TZones/Internet button' method implemented in some ROMs?...for any of them there is a way to check the link....
I mentioned above how to check for Start Menu....
For the CComm Panel, go into the registry with a registry editor...Navigate to H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Microsoft\CHome\CComm\ ... in there should be keys named "Page1", Page2 and so on...check each of them for "SK2URL" and make sure that for each the value is "\Windows\CommManager.exe" (no quotes " ")
For the holding down of the TZones/Internet button, go to the windows directory and look for long_IE.lnk (i think that is what it is called, im not sure though...my phone doesnt have that) and make sure it points to the correct file...
That is really all i can think of...hope it helps

For starters, why is it "CommManagerlink.exe", it should just be "CommManager.exe", unless that is how the ROM was cooked.
Okay, try this...
First, go to the WINDOWS directory, and find CommManager.exe, and click it. If it works, then the shortcut is the problem...if so move on to the next 'step'...
Using a file explorer, make a backup copy of the .lnk file (just do a duplicate, or copy and paste into a new folder) just incase something goes wrong.
Now, for the first try, just change "CommManagerlink.exe" to "CommManager.exe" (obviously, no " "). if that doesn't work, do the next method.
If the first method didn't work, try replacing the contents of the .lnk file with
39#"\Windows\CommManager.exe"
If that method did not work, then I am really not sure what is wrong.
